public virtual ITNDApplicationBuis Init(TNDApplicationModel applicationModel, ITNDNotifyIconBuis notifyIconBuis)
 {
     this._ApplicationModel = applicationModel;
     this._NotifyIconBuis   = notifyIconBuis;
     this._NotifyIconBuis.ShowMessage("Starting...");
     return(this);
 }
 protected virtual void Dispose(bool disposing)
 {
     using (var ni = this._NotifyIconBuis as IDisposable) {
         if (disposing)
         {
             this._NotifyIconBuis = null;
         }
     }
 }
Example #3
0
 public override ITNDApplicationBuis Init(TNDApplicationModel applicationModel, ITNDNotifyIconBuis notifyIconBuis)
 {
     // read from settings
     try {
         if (applicationModel.ConfigurationSource == null)
         {
             var configurationSource = TagNDrop.Properties.Settings.Default?.ConfigurationSource;
             applicationModel.ConfigurationSource = configurationSource;
         }
         return(base.Init(applicationModel, notifyIconBuis));
     } catch (Exception exception) {
         App.ApplicationBuis.OnFatalException("TNDApplicationBuis2.Init", exception);
         return(this);
     }
 }